Climate overview of Pedras Salgadas
Pedras Salgadas, Norte Region, Portugal, sees big temperature differences between seasons, with July peaking at 28°C (82°F) and January dropping to 11°C (52°F).
The city receives considerable rain/snowfall, with around 1004 mm (40 in) annually. October is the wettest month. It has a distinct dry season from July to August, with warm summers and cold winters.

Monthly Temperature in Pedras Salgadas
Visitors to Pedras Salgadas can expect significant temperature changes throughout the year. Typically, average maximum daytime temperatures range from a comfortable 28°C (82°F) in July to a chilly 11°C (52°F) in the coolest month, January.
Nights vary from 14°C (57°F) in July to around 3°C (37°F) during the colder months.

Rainfall in Pedras Salgadas
Pedras Salgadas is known for its substantial rain/snowfall, with annual precipitation reaching 1004 mm (40 in). The climate in Pedras Salgadas shows significant variation throughout the year. Expect high rainfall in October, the wettest month, with an average of 136 mm (5.4 in) of precipitation over 14 rainy days.
In contrast, the driest month July offers drier and sunnier days, with around 22 mm (0.9 in) of rainfall over 7 rainy days. For more details, please visit our Pedras Salgadas Precipitation page.
